Quote:
Originally Posted by red76TA
its gonna be alot of work and probably a good bit of fabrication to make it all work correctly
you will have to make motor mounts (they might make them) may have to modify your floor pan, etc
just think if a part that is designed to fit usually has to be modified to fit correctly, something thats not designed to fit will probably require quite a bit of fabrication and "massaging"

Not true. motor mounts are being made for this swap as are headers to fit f-body and a-body cars with the ls-x engines. The transtunnel will have to be opened up. It not as big a deal as some make it out to be. Year One offers complete LS1 engine and transmission mounting kits for '67-69 and '70-81 Camaros. The kits include engine mounts, a transmission crossmember, and transmission mount. Kits are available for both 4L60-E automatic transmissions or T-56 six-speed transmissions and for cars using the OEM steering or Fourth-Gen F-body rack-and-pinion conversions. These kits should also work with Firebirds.
